Fix profile after fnsplit
when splitting functions, tree-inline determined correctly entry count of the
new function part, but then in case entry block of new function part is in a
loop it scales body which is not suposed to happen.
* tree-inline.cc (copy_cfg_body): Fix profile of split functions.
